Resumen

Multi-functional and multivalent angiogenesis inhibitor formed by fusion protein, this fusion protein comprises polypeptide in the molecular function active zone which participate in the potent angiogenesis process, discerns and blocks, and polypeptide comprising domain of oligomerization and depressor or regulator with active potent angiogenesis process of effects, it is seperated that domain and depressor or regulator of wherein said oligomerization are sensitive protease. Said depressor is suitable for preventing and treating pathologic process occuring in potent angiogenesis process, such as cancer, rheumatic arthritis or psoriasis.

Reivindicaciones

1. An oligomeric protein comprising 2, 3, or 4 fusion proteins, wherein each fusion protein comprises: a) a polypeptide (A') comprising a region which recognizes and blocks a functionally active region of a molecule involved in the angiogenesis process, said polypeptide being an antibody which recognizes and blocks a functionally active region of a molecule involved in the angiogenesis process or a recombinant fragment thereof which recognizes and blocks a functionally active region of a molecule involved in the angiogenesis process; and b) a polypeptide (B') comprising (i) an oligomerization domain, (ii) an angiogenesis process inhibitor or modulator peptide or protein, and (iii) a proteinase-sensitive region between said oligomerization domain and said angiogenesis process inhibitor or modulator peptide or protein. 2. Oligomeric protein according to claim 1, wherein said molecule involved in the angiogenesis process is a protein of the extracellular matrix (ECM), an angiogenic factor or a cell membrane receptor. 3. Oligomeric protein according to claim 2, wherein said molecule involved in the angiogenesis process is collagen, a proteoglycan, fibronectin, laminin, tenascin, entactin, thrombospondin, vascular endothelial growth factor (VEGF), VEGF receptor 2 (VEGFR-2) or an integrin<.> 4. Oligomeric protein according to claim 3, wherein said laminin is a mammal laminin, preferably a rat, mouse or human laminin. 5. Oligomeric protein according to anyone of claims 1 to 4, wherein said polypeptide (A') is a single chain Fv fragment (scFv) of an antibody which recognizes a molecule involved in the angiogenesis process or a diabody recognizing said molecule involved in the angiogenesis process. 6. Oligomeric protein according to claim 1, wherein said polypeptide (B') comprises the NC1 domain of mammal collagen XV or the NC1 domain of mammal collagen XVIII. 7. Oligomeric protein according to claim 1, comprising, between said polypeptides (A') and (B'), a third polypeptide (C') comprising the amino acid sequence of a flexible binding peptide. 8. Oligomeric protein according to claim 1, said oligomeric protein being a trimer consisting of 3 fusion proteins, wherein each fusion protein comprises: a) a polypeptide (A'), said polypeptide (A') being a single chain Fv fragment (scFv) of an antibody which recognizes a laminin, and b) a polypeptide (B'), said polypeptide (B') comprising the NC1 domain of mammal collagen XVIII. 9. A pharmaceutical composition comprising a oligomeric protein according to any of claims 1 to 8 together with at least one pharmaceutically acceptable excipient. 10. Use of an oligomeric protein according to any of claims 1 to 8, in the manufacture of a pharmaceutical composition to prevent, treat, impede or minimize angiogenesis development. 11. Use of an oligomeric protein according to any of claims 1 to 8, in the manufacture of a pharmaceutical composition for treating or preventing pathologies occurring with angiogenesis. 12. Use according to claim 11, wherein said pathology occurring with angiogenesis comprises cancer, hemangioma, rheumatic arthritis, psoriasis, bartonellosis, transplanted organ rejection, bleeding, ocular neovascularization, retinopathies, macular degeneration, neovascular glaucoma, retinal vein occlusion, retinal artery occlusion, pterygium, rubeosis, or corneal neovascularization. 13.
